The Paralympian, Anea Clement of Grenada is all set to participate in the upcoming World Boccia Technical Training Camp. This camp has been scheduled to take place in Cali, Colombia from Sunday, 29th September to Thursday, 3rd October, 2024, enhancing the skills and techniques of all the participants.

Anea Clement will be accompanied by her coach, Glen Alexander and mother, Cassandra Clement, as part of her Assistant team in her visit to Colombia. All the three members will depart for Colombia on Saturday, 28th September, 2024.
Boccia is a precision ball sport that tests the physical and mental capabilities of athletes. In this sport, a player in seated position propels balls to land as close as possible to a white marker ball, known as the Jack. The two sides compete as individuals, pairs or as a team of three over a set number of ends.
The participation by Anea Clement marks a significant step in the development of the sport on the island nation. Her participation in the Camp would play a huge role in helping her learn new techniques and skills which will later benefit her in future.
Moreover, the Ministry of Youth and Sports of Grenada commanded the Government, World Boccia, Grenada National Council for People with Disability and Grenada Paralympic Committee for making this trip possible.
They also extended best wises to Anea Clement, her coach, Glen Alexander, and her mother, Cassandra Clement for a safe and successful journey. They also appreciated them in representing the country with utmost pride.
World Boccia is a non-profit organization and public-facing brand for the Boccia International Sports Federation (BISFed) which is responsible for governing the sport of Boccia across the globe.
In this training camp, the organizers conduct training sessions, master classes, training seminars with professional trainers, highly qualified teachers and the best players from around the world. The regular lessons in World Boccia Technical Training Camp plays a huge role in developing dexterity, accuracy, endurance, coordination of movements, and also helps to think tactically.
